Residential Stucco for Bakersfield Homes: What to Expect

Residential stucco is a versatile exterior finish applied to homes, providing both protection and aesthetic appeal. It typically involves several layers, starting with a weather-resistant barrier over your existing sheathing, followed by metal lath, a scratch coat, a brown coat, and finally, a finish coat. This process creates a hard, durable surface that guards your home against the elements, helps with insulation, and offers a wide range of textures and colors to match your home's style right here in Bakersfield.

For Bakersfield homeowners, residential stucco is particularly important due to our unique climate. The dry heat and occasional strong winds can be tough on exterior surfaces. Stucco provides an excellent barrier against these conditions, helping to maintain your home's internal temperature and reducing wear and tear. It's a smart investment that protects your home's structure and keeps it looking sharp among the diverse homes across our community, from the historic homes near downtown to newer builds in the Rosedale area.

Homeowners often wonder about the longevity and maintenance of stucco. A well-applied stucco system can last for decades, often 30 years or more, with minimal upkeep. Regular cleaning and occasional inspections for cracks are usually all that's needed. Why is Residential Stucco a Smart Choice for Bakersfield Homes?

Residential stucco is an excellent choice for Bakersfield homes because it handles our local climate really well. Our hot, dry summers and cooler winters can cause other materials to crack or fade quickly. Stucco, when properly installed, expands and contracts with temperature changes, making it far more resistant to these issues than many alternatives. It helps keep your home cooler in the summer, potentially lowering those high AC bills we all know too well.

Beyond just temperature, stucco offers fantastic fire resistance, which is a real plus in our dry environment. It's a non-combustible material, adding an extra layer of safety for your family and property. Plus, it's a great sound barrier, helping to keep outside noise out, which is nice if you live near a busy street or just appreciate a quieter home life.

Residential stucco installation in Bakersfield typically takes between 7 to 14 days for an average-sized home, depending on the complexity of the project and weather conditions. This timeframe includes preparation, application of multiple coats, and drying time for each layer. Larger or more intricate homes may require a bit more time to ensure a quality finish that stands up to our local climate.
Yes, residential stucco significantly helps with energy efficiency in Bakersfield's hot climate. The multiple layers of stucco, especially when combined with a proper insulation system, create a thermal mass that slows down heat transfer into your home. This can lead to a cooler indoor environment during our hot summers and potentially lower your cooling costs, making your home more comfortable year-round.
Residential stucco in Bakersfield requires relatively low maintenance. We recommend a gentle cleaning every few years to remove dust and dirt, which can be done with a garden hose and a soft brush. It's also a good idea to periodically inspect for any hairline cracks, especially after significant temperature changes, and address them promptly to prevent moisture intrusion. Proper maintenance helps extend the life and beauty of your stucco.
